Mission

MURAL ARTS - THE CITY OF PHILADELPHIA MURAL ARTS PROGRAM UNITES ARTISTS AND COMMUNITIES THROUGH A COLLABORATIVE PROCESS ROOTED IN THE TRADITIONS OF MURAL MAKING, TO CREATE ART THAT TRANSFORMS PUBLIC SPACES AND INDIVIDUAL LIVES.

Pay in context

Top pay as a share of expenses

In 2023, the highest total compensation at PHILADELPHIA MURAL ARTS ADVOCATES INC equaled 0.8% of the organization's total expenses. The median for arts, culture & humanities organizations is 11%.

This organization (2023)
0.8%
Sector median
11%
Middle half of sector
5% to 20%

Based on 17,098 arts, culture & humanities organizations, each measured at its most recent filing year with reported expenses and compensation.
